The Associate Record to Analyze Process Expert supports the design, improvement and implementation of finance processes covering record-to-report, reporting and analysis, typically within SAP and related enterprise platforms. Candidates are expected to understand accounting and financial controls, document business requirements, support process workshops, test system changes and work with technical and business teams. Familiarity with SAP S/4HANA, SAP BTP, finance integration, data reporting and process documentation is valuable. Strong analytical, communication and problem-solving skills are required, together with the ability to work in international project teams. Relevant finance, business, information systems or engineering qualifications and professional consulting experience would be advantageous.
Capgemini is a global business and technology transformation company headquartered in France, serving clients across industries including financial services, manufacturing, retail, telecommunications and the public sector. Its services cover consulting, technology implementation, engineering, cloud, data and art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, business process services and managed operations. Capgemini works with major enterprise platforms such as SAP, helping organizations modernize finance, supply chains, customer operations and wider digital infrastructure. The company has a large international workforce and frequently delivers projects through multicultural, distributed teams. In Malaysia, its roles commonly involve technology delivery, enterprise applications, shared services and consulting support for regional and global clients. Employees can expect structured project methods, collaboration with specialists in other countries and opportunities to develop certifications in SAP, cloud and emerging technologies.
Malaysia offers varied opportunities in Kuala Lumpur, Penang, Johor and other locations, particularly in technology consulting, SAP, shared services, finance, engineering, manufacturing, tourism and digital operations. Kuala Lumpur is the main corporate hub, while Penang is known for electronics and a relaxed island lifestyle. Malaysian culture blends Malay, Chinese, Indian and indigenous traditions, with excellent food, festivals and generally welcoming communities. Living costs are moderate compared with many international business centers, although central Kuala Lumpur housing is more expensive. Beaches, rainforests and islands are accessible for weekend travel, while public transport is strongest in major cities. Foreign professionals normally need employer sponsorship for an Employment Pass; the company generally submits the application and supporting documents. Candidates should confirm salary, healthcare, tax, relocation assistance and pass eligibility before accepting an offer. English is widely used in professional workplaces, though learning basic Malay helps daily life.
